编程中鸣机器人是什么
-
编程中“鸣”机器人是指通过编写代码或使用特定的软件工具,使机器人能够发出声音的功能。这种功能通常用于与用户进行语音交互、提供语音提示或警报等。
在实现机器人发声的过程中,通常需要使用到音频库、音频处理算法和音频设备等。通过对声音进行编码和解码,机器人可以生成各种声音效果,如音乐、语音合成和环境音效等。
对于编程中的“鸣”机器人,常见的方法包括:
- 使用音频库:许多编程语言和开发平台都提供了用于处理音频的库或模块,例如Python中的pyaudio库、Java中的javax.sound包等。通过调用这些库中的函数或方法,可以实现机器人的发声功能。
- 使用语音合成技术:语音合成是指将文本转换成语音的技术。通过使用语音合成引擎,可以将文本转换成机器人可理解的声音。常见的语音合成引擎包括Microsoft Azure的Text-to-Speech、Google Cloud的Text-to-Speech等。
- 使用硬件设备:除了软件层面的编程,还可以通过连接外部硬件设备来实现机器人的发声功能。例如,可以使用扬声器、音箱或蓝牙耳机等外部设备来播放机器人发出的声音。
总而言之,编程中的“鸣”机器人是通过编写代码或使用特定软件工具,使机器人能够发出声音的功能。这种功能可以通过音频库、语音合成技术或连接外部硬件设备等方式来实现。
1年前 -
在编程中,鸣机器人是指一种能够模拟人类语音和进行对话的智能机器人。它通过使用语音合成技术将文字转换为语音,并使用语音识别技术将语音转换为文字,从而实现与用户的交互。
鸣机器人在编程中起到了许多重要的作用。以下是关于鸣机器人的五个重要方面:
-
语音交互:鸣机器人能够通过语音与用户进行交互,这为用户提供了更加便捷和自然的交流方式。用户可以通过语音命令来控制机器人执行特定的任务,比如查询天气、播放音乐等。
-
自然语言处理:鸣机器人可以理解和解析用户的自然语言,通过自然语言处理技术,机器人能够理解用户的意图,并给出相应的回应。这使得用户可以更加直观地与机器人进行对话,而无需关注特定的命令格式或语法。
-
文字转语音:鸣机器人能够将文字转换为语音,这在一些场景中非常有用。比如,在无法直接显示文字的设备上,用户可以通过鸣机器人将文字内容以语音的形式进行播报。
-
语音转文字:鸣机器人能够将语音转换为文字,这对于一些需要对语音进行分析和处理的应用非常重要。比如,语音识别技术可以应用于语音助手、语音翻译等领域。
-
个性化定制:鸣机器人还可以根据用户的需求进行个性化定制。通过编程,用户可以为机器人添加特定的功能或行为,使其更好地适应自己的需求和喜好。
总之,鸣机器人在编程中扮演着重要的角色,它不仅提供了更加自然和便捷的交流方式,还能够通过语音合成和语音识别等技术为用户带来更多的便利和个性化体验。
1年前 -
-
编程中的鸣机器人(MeeBot)是一种用于教授编程和机器人控制的教育工具。它是由Makeblock公司开发的一款教育机器人,旨在帮助学生学习编程、STEM(科学、技术、工程和数学)以及创造力思维。
MeeBot机器人的主要特点是它的可编程性和可移动性。它配备了多个电机和传感器,可以执行各种动作和任务。通过编程,用户可以控制MeeBot机器人的运动、表情和声音,从而创造出自己想要的交互体验。
以下是使用MeeBot机器人进行编程的方法和操作流程:
-
准备工作:首先,需要确保MeeBot机器人已经组装好并连接到计算机或移动设备。使用MeeBot机器人的编程软件之前,还需要安装相应的软件和驱动程序。
-
连接设备:将MeeBot机器人通过USB线缆或蓝牙连接到计算机或移动设备。确保连接稳定并识别到机器人。
-
编程软件:启动MeeBot机器人的编程软件。根据你使用的平台(Windows、Mac、iOS或Android),选择相应的软件版本。
-
编程界面:在编程软件中,会显示一个编程界面。该界面通常分为多个部分,包括舞台区域、编程块区域和代码区域。
-
基础编程块:MeeBot机器人的编程软件通常采用可视化编程的方式,使用拖拽和连接编程块的方式来编写程序。在编程块区域中,可以找到各种基础的编程块,如运动控制、传感器读取、判断语句等。
-
编写程序:通过拖拽和连接编程块,编写程序来控制MeeBot机器人的行为。可以使用运动控制块来控制机器人的运动,使用传感器读取块来获取机器人周围环境的信息,使用判断语句来根据条件执行不同的动作等。
-
调试和测试:编写完程序后,可以通过点击运行按钮来测试程序的效果。如果程序有错误或需要调试,可以使用调试工具来逐步执行程序并观察机器人的行为。
-
扩展功能:除了基本的运动控制和传感器读取,MeeBot机器人还支持一些扩展功能,如音乐播放、舞蹈等。可以通过添加相应的编程块来实现这些功能。
-
分享和交流:在完成编程和测试后,可以将程序保存并分享给其他人。还可以加入MeeBot机器人的社区,与其他编程爱好者交流经验和创意。
总结:编程中的鸣机器人是一种用于教授编程和机器人控制的教育工具。通过使用编程软件,用户可以控制机器人的运动、表情和声音,从而创造出各种交互体验。编程过程中,需要连接设备、使用编程软件、编写程序,并通过调试和测试来验证程序的效果。使用MeeBot机器人进行编程可以帮助学生学习编程、STEM和创造力思维。
1年前 -